Laravel: Какое событие происходит, когда пользователь становится онлайн? (эхо и трансляция) - PullRequest
0 голосов
/ 25 февраля 2020

Я включаю приложение Laravel в качестве веб-службы для мобильного приложения. Мне нужно знать, какие пользователи в сети в любой момент, поэтому я использую Laravel -echo и Laravel -echo-server, а также Redis и Socket.io для этого. Я новичок в эхо / вещании, и это первый раз, когда я имею дело с такой проблемой.

Из того, что я вижу в разных уроках, мне нужно создать частные или публичные c каналы, и соответствующие события должны быть выстрелил внутри каналов.

Я видел разные уроки, но до сих пор не могу до конца понять. Проблема в том, что я не знаю, как определить, кто-то в сети или нет. Когда пользователь подключается к сети, я могу обнаружить его, но не могу определить, находится ли он в автономном режиме, отключив inte rnet или отключив мобильный телефон или et c, и какие события на стороне сервера должны быть запущены.

Буду признателен за любую помощь. Заранее спасибо.

...